Zondria Campbell - Arkansas Executive Director
![]() |
Zondria Campbell brings more than 20 years of distinguished service in education to her role as Executive Director of AMS Arkansas. Her professional experience spans multiple levels of the K–12 system, including roles as a teacher, school counselor, assistant principal, and principal. This diverse background has equipped her with a comprehensive understanding of instructional leadership, student supports, and the operational structures necessary for school success.
Ms. Campbell has a strong record of strengthening academic programs, advancing data-driven instructional practices, and cultivating school cultures grounded in high expectations, collaboration, and continuous improvement. Most recently, she served as Principal of Joe T. Robinson Middle School, where she led initiatives that elevated student achievement, enhanced staff professional learning communities, and reinforced systems that supported both academic and social-emotional growth.
Her academic preparation reflects her commitment to educational excellence. Ms. Campbell earned her bachelor's and master's degrees from the University of Arkansas at Little Rock, followed by an Educational Specialist degree from Harding University. She is currently pursuing her Doctorate at Arkansas Tech University, where her research focuses on leadership practices in high-performing Arkansas schools.
As Executive Director of AMS Arkansas, Ms. Campbell is dedicated to advancing rigorous instruction, supporting strong campus leadership, and ensuring that every school has the structures and coaching necessary for students to thrive. She looks forward to working closely with AMS staff, families, and community stakeholders to further strengthen the academic and operational vision of AMS Arkansas.
